To find the total floor area \( A \) of all the offices in the building, you can use the equation:
\[
A = n \times a
\]
where:
- \( A \) is the total floor area,
- \( n \) is the number of offices, and
- \( a \) is the floor area of each office.
In this scenario:
- \( n = 23 \) (the number of offices),
- \( a = 305 \) square feet (the floor area of each office).
Plugging in the values:
\[
A = 23 \times 305
\]
Calculating this gives:
\[
A = 7015 \text{ square feet}
\]
So the total floor area of all the offices is 7015 square feet.
